Q. Open-loop control system?
An open-loop system is one in which the control action is independent of the output or desired result, whereas a closed-loop (feedback) system is one in which the control action is dependent upon the output. In the case of the open-loop system, the input command (actuating signal) is the sole factor responsible for providing the control action, whereas for a closed-loop system the control action is provided by the difference between the input command and the corresponding output.
The elements of an open-loop control system may be divided into two parts: the controller and the controlled process, as shown by the block diagram of Figure. An input signal or command r is applied to the controller, whose output acts as the actuating signal u. The actuating signal then controls the controlled process such that the controlled variable c will perform according to some prescribed standards. The controller may be an amplifier, mechanical linkage, or other basic control means in simple cases, whereas in more sophisticated electronics control, it can be an electronic computer such as a microprocessor.
